I hope that topic heading gets me a response or two. I leased a new MME a few days ago. My dealer no longer stocks the home chargers that are part of the Power Promise Program. They said I'd receive an email "soon" about getting one.
- How long has it taken lately (Aug, 2025) for you to get their email?
- I assume the email just allows me to order it, right? So how long after you order it till it arrived?
- Is it correct that I can't have QMERIT out to plan and estimate the cost of my install until after I receive the charger?
- How long has it taken lately to get the install done after QMERIT comes out and plans the work?

Finally, I know installations can be tricky, but I also don't want QMERIT to pull any kind of "extra cost reqired" stuff for my install. It will be in an attached garage of a 20-year old suburban house where the electrical box is about 10-15 feet away from where I want the charger installed and the meter is attached to the side of the garage. Seems like that shold be as "standard" as it gets and should not require any special charges. But I don't know anything about electrical work. In situations like mine is the full installation cost usually covered?

I wanted to share some details regarding the installation of my charger for the MME I picked up my MME on May 14th, 2025. The dealer provided the charger at the time of delivery, and about three weeks later, I received an email from QMerit regarding the installation. The installation was successfully completed within the following two weeks.

I bought the car 07/29 and got the qmerit email 08/03. I got the qmerit email a couple days before the coupon code email which finally arrived 08/05.. Charger was out of stock until last Friday. I ordered it that day and it arrives tomorrow. Local installer, assigned by qmerit, wants me to pay $45 for the permit. I guess the power promise doesn’t cover that.

he told me ford gives them $1500 and after telling me how they wanted to run it (drill to the exterior wall, run conduit down across the ground, then back up to where my charger will be and drill another hole to get back into the garage) I politely declined and wired it myself. All I need is for the charger to arrive.

I think the email is sent within 1-2 business days of them submitting the deal in Ford’s sales system. If there is a delay, it’s probably because they have not yet properly entered the deal as sold, they didn’t apply the correct incentive code, or they have your wrong email address (it must match your FordPass account email address). Some dealers suck and don’t do their paperwork correctly, or in a timely fashion. If you don’t have the email within about a week of buying the car, you need to bug the sales manager, and ensure the deal and incentives were entered properly. Tell them a 5-star review is at risk if you don’t get those codes.

Explore the forums and you'll see a variety of Power Promise experiences.
My dealer was familiar with the program.

My EVSE installation success using the program in January took 29 days from car delivery to home charging.

There was some extra expense and an eventual divorce from qmerit for reasons.

Stay flexible, stay engaged, get multiple quotes from other electricians.

it was a little stessful in the dead of winter, but haven't given daily driving charging a second thought since.
